What companies run services between Beaconsfield, England and Felixstowe, England?

You can take a train from Beaconsfield to Felixstowe via London Marylebone, Baker Street station, Liverpool Street station, London Liverpool Street, and Ipswich in around 3h 20m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Maxwell Road to Conkers via Heathrow Central Bus Station, Coach Station, Cardinal Park Cinema, and Old Cattle Market Bus Station in around 6h 7m.
